What are the STAR Awards?
In 1996 Missouri State University hosted the first ever Student Talent and Recognition (STAR) Awards Ceremony. Each year the STAR Awards ceremony honors outstanding student leaders and student organizations which have been nominated by various organizations, students, faculty, and staff. Since its beginning, STAR Awards has recognized over 350 students, organizations, and advisors at Missouri State.
About the awards and application process
On average, 150 applications are submitted to the Office of Student Engagement each year and nominations are taken from faculty, staff, students, and student organizations. We encourage you to make nominations for every award possible, for there are two categories: organization and individual.
No applications will be accepted via email or physically. Only those submitted utilizing the online nomination form will be accepted.
